 Actress Offered Free Gambling Privileges

- Monday, 17 Oct 2005

A week ago, we reported that actress Cameron Diaz has admitted to have a poker gambling addiction. As a result of her remarks, Diaz was approached by an online gambling site by the name of BetCRIS, offering her to serve as the site’s spokesperson. The endorsement deal is reportedly worth $1.5 million, including a monthly retainer and a free gambling account. As of yet, it’s unclear whether or not the actress has accepted the deal.

This is a second time this month that an online gambling site approaches a high-profile celebrity. A few weeks ago, a British newspaper published photos of Moss allegedly snorting cocaine. Once these pictures were made public, Moss lost all of her sponsors and found herself in a situation in which couldn’t get work on the runway. Upon losing all of her sponsors, an online gambling site offered Moss an endorsement deal, which she ended up rejecting.

This recurring trend of recruiting celebrity spokespersons seems to one of the major promotional tactics taken by gambling sites these days. The motivation for doing that is quite obvious, which is to associate a famous face wit their product. Since all these site offer pretty much the same product (i.e. gambling), one of the few things that separate them is the “package”.
